Notes:
A rf-driven discharge is used to produce a beam of metastable krypton atoms at the 5s(3/2)2 level with an angular flux density of 4×1014 s−1 sr−1 and most probable velocity of 290 m/s, while consuming 7×1016 krypton atoms/s. When operated in a gas-recirculation mode, the source consumes 2×1015 krypton atoms/s with the same atomic-beam output. © 2001 American Institute of Physics.
